## Occupancy feed: restart procedure

The Garveston occupancy feed aggregates stall sensors from all Mirefield garages and publishes counts every 20 seconds. Plugin authors consuming this feed should note that after a restart, counts are stale for up to two polling cycles; your plugin must tolerate this. If the feed flatlines, restart the aggregator rather than individual sensor bridges. The aggregator requires the configuration values listed immediately below.

settings of hawif-faduf:
quenath:
  log_level: error
  metrics_host: metrics.quenath.lumiclabs.internal
  pin: 2627
  pool_size: 32

### Step 4: Enable fan-out backpressure

Before flipping on the new backpressure limits for Pinewhistle notifications, make sure the fan-out workers are all on build 2.9 or later — older workers will just drop messages instead of queuing politely. Support folks: if customers report delayed notifications right after this step, that's expected for a few minutes. The deploy bundle is verified against the key below.

signing key of bagap-yawep = bky13_TbfT6ZMUoGJo2

Subject: Offline mode cut-over — done!

Hi all, quick note for folks just joining: we finished moving Fernpath Survey to the new offline mode last night. Field crews can now queue submissions without signal, and sync kicks in automatically when coverage returns. If you're setting up a local build, start with these configuration values.

service settings:
novath:
  pin: 1396
  tenant: pelys
  seal: seal_ccc035e1
  metrics_host: metrics.novath.qorvelworks.test
  standby_team: fraeth
  escalation: drueth-zorok
  nonce: 61d508